Understanding Protein Synthesis

Protein synthesis involves various cellular processes that create new proteins based on the genetic instructions contained in DNA. These proteins include enzymes, hormones, and structural components of muscle tissue. When you engage in resistance training, you create small tears in your muscle fibers, which need to be repaired. This is where protein synthesis comes into play.

Why Protein Synthesis Matters for Muscle Growth

The process of protein synthesis is essential for enhancing muscle size and strength. Here are some key reasons why:

  1. Repair and Recovery: After an intensive workout, protein synthesis helps repair the damaged muscle fibers, making them stronger and larger than before.
  2. Muscle Adaptation: Over time, as your muscles adapt to the stress of lifting weights, protein synthesis facilitates muscle hypertrophy—an increase in muscle size.
  3. Nutritional Support: Adequate protein intake boosts the rate of protein synthesis, providing the building blocks necessary for new muscle growth.

How to Maximize Protein Synthesis

To ensure that your body is effectively synthesizing protein for muscle growth, consider the following tips:

  1. Consume Sufficient Protein: Aim for a daily protein intake that supports your workout regimen, typically around 1.6 to 2.2 grams of protein per kilogram of body weight.
  2. Timing Matters: Consuming protein-rich meals or supplements shortly after your workout can enhance recovery and spur protein synthesis.
  3. Focus on Quality: Choose high-quality protein sources, such as lean meats, fish, dairy, legumes, and nuts, to provide essential amino acids.
